Projeto de uma empresa
Por: Aquivcpdlucas • 16/10/2015 • Trabalho acadêmico • 620 Palavras (3 Páginas) • 996 Visualizações
PROJETO PARA INFORMATIZAÇÃO DE UMA BIBLIOTECA
OBJETIVOS
1 - Armazenar informações referente a empréstimo de livros; cadastro e consultas de livros, autores, usuários, editoras.
O projeto será demonstrado em todas as suas fases desde o seu início
Levantamento de dados:
- Constatou-se que a biblioteca encontrava grandes dificuldades em armazenar suas informações em fichas, coletamos as informações pertinentes às atividades, para poder dar início ao modelo conceitual
Modelo Conceitual:
Cadastro de Livros (Nome do livro, Editora, Autor);
Cadastro de Autores(nome do Autor);
Cadastro de Usuários (nome do usuário, curso, Matricula);
Cadastro de Emprestimos (livro, usuario do livro, data);
Cadastro de editoras (nome da editora).
Segue a seguirrepresentação gráfica do modelo conceitual, deacordo com levantamento realizado.
Representação do Modelo Lógico..
[pic 1]
Após Criação do modelo lógico, segue as cardinalidades, conforme figura a seguir:
[pic 2]
Agora Passaremos a para a criação do modelo físico, SGDB, ENTIDADES
ENTIDADES
1 - LIVROS - A entidade livros, refere-se ao cadastro da coleção de exemplares.
ATRIBUTOS da entidade livros:
A) cod_liv, refere-se ao código individual de cada livro, é uma chave primária
B) nome_liv, refere-se ao nome do exemplar(livro)
D) edi_liv , refere-se à editora do do livro
E) aut_liv – refere-se ao autor do livro
2 – CURSOS, a entidade cursos armazena informações referente aos cursos existentes na escola referente aos usuários(alunos)
ATRIBUTOS da entidade cursos:
- cod_cur , armazana o código individual de cada curso, chave pimária
- nome_cur, armazena o nome de cada curso ofertado pela escola
3) AUTORES, entidade que armazena o nome dos autores dos livros cadastrados
ATRIBUTOS da entidade autores:
- cod_aut, atributo que armazena código individual de cada autor, chave primária
- nome_aut, a tributo que armazena o nome do autor
4) EDITORAS, esta entidade armazenará os dados das editoras dos exemplares
ATRIBUTOS da entidade editora:
- cod_edi, atributo que armazena o código da editora, chave primária
- nome_edi, atributo que armazena o nome da editora
5) EMPRESTIMO, entidade que armazena informações referente a movimentação do livros, e os usuários que os emprestam.
ATRIBUTOS da entidade emprestimo:
- cod_emp, registra o código da movimentação(empréstimo),chave primária
- liv_emp, registra o código do livro a ser emprestado, chave estrangeira
- user_emp, registra o código do usuário(aluno) que esta emprestando o livro, chave estrangeira
- data_emp, registra a data da movimentação(empréstimo).
DETALHAMENTO DA TABELA USUARIO
NOME DO CAMPO | TIPO DE DADO | TAMANHO |
CODIGO | NUMÉRICO-AUTOINCREMENTO | VARIÁEL |
NOME DO USUÁRIO | ALFANUMÉRICO | 30 |
CURSO | ALFANUMÉRICO | 3 |
DETALHAMENTO DA TABELA LIVRO
NOME DO CAMPO | TIPO DE DADO | TAMANHO |
CODIGO | NUMÉRICO-AUTOINCREMENTO | VARIÁVEL |
NOME DO LIVRO | ALFANUMÉRICO | 30 |
EDITORA | ALFANUMÉRICO | 3 |
AUTOR | ALFANUMÉRICO | 3 |
DETALHAMENTO DA TABELA EDITORA
NOME DO CAMPO | TIPO DE DADO | TAMANHO |
CODIGO | NUMÉRICO-AUTOINCREMENTO | VARIÁVEL |
NOME DA EDITORA | ALFANUMÉRICO | 30 |
DETALHAMENTO DA TABELA AUTOR
NOME DO CAMPO | TIPO DE DADO | TAMANHO |
CODIGO | NUMÉRICO-AUTOINCREMENTO | VARIÁVEL |
NOME DO AUTOR | ALFANUMÉRICO | 30 |
DETALHAMENTO DA TABELA EMPRÉSTIMO
...